O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 3

A sample of water was found to contain Ca2+ ions. Which of these will be preferred for washing clothes?

Detailed Solution for O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 3

Ca2+ ions present makes the water hard so detergents are used to wash clothes. Detergents contain sodium carbonate (NaCO3) which has the power to remove calcium and magnesium ions in the hard water. When this NaCO3 dissolves in water it gets split into Na and CO3 . This CO3 reacts with Ca and Mg ions to form calcium carbonate (CaCO3) and magnesium carbonate (MgCO3) .

O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 5

Butylated – Hydroxy Toluene is added in packed foods to preserve fats because

Detailed Solution for O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 5

Butylated hydroxy toluene (BHT) is used as an antioxidant. It retards the action of oxygen on the food material and thereby helps in preventing oxidative rancidity of fats.It itself get oxidized and prevent the food.

O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 7

Hormones relating to birth control are

Detailed Solution for O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 7

Oral contraceptive pills are either combined estrogen-progesterone(also called combined oral contraceptive pill- COC) or progesterone-only pill (POP). The most commonly prescribed pill is the combined hormonal pill with estrogen and progesterone. Progesterone is the hormone that prevents pregnancy, and the estrogen component controls menstrual bleeding.

O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 9

Some of the detergents are non – biodegradable because

Detailed Solution for O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 9

Non-biodegradable detergents are defined as the type of detergent that has a branched hydrocarbon chain. These are known as non-biodegradable because bacteria cannot act on them. These are one of the sources of pollution. Cetyl methyl ammonium bromide is an example of non-biodegradable.

O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 11

Norethindrone is a

Detailed Solution for O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 11

Norethindrone is synthetic infertility drug. Norethindrone is a form of progesterone, a female hormone important for regulating ovulation and menstruation. Norethindrone is used for birth control (contraception) to prevent pregnancy. Norethindrone is also used to treat menstrual disorders, endometriosis, or abnormal vaginal bleeding caused by a hormone imbalance.

O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 15

Ortho – sulphobenzimide is

Detailed Solution for O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 15

Sodium saccharin (benzoic sulfimide) is an artificial sweetener with effectively no food energy. It is about 300–400 times as sweet as sucrose but has a bitter or metallic aftertaste, especially at high concentrations. Saccharin is used to sweeten products such as drinks, candies, cookies, and medicines.

O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 16

The element in soap which makes it soft on skin is

Detailed Solution for O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 16

Depending on the intended application of the soap, sodium hydroxide or potassium hydroxide is generally used as an alkali. If potassium hydroxide is used, it produces a more water-soluble product than its sodium-based counterpart, and is thus often called “soft soap”.

O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 18

The colloidal soap is precipitated by

Detailed Solution for O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 18

Colloidal soap is precipitated by adding NaCl. Sodium chloride is added to precipitate soap after saponficiation because hydrolysis of esters of long chain fatty acids by alkali produces soap in colloidal form.

O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 20

Drugs, which inhibit the enzymes that catalyze the degradation of noradrenaline, are

Detailed Solution for O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 20

Anti-depressant drugs are needed to cure this problem. They inhibit enzymes that catalyze noradrenaline degradation. Hence, the metabolism of noradrenaline is slowed down and the neurotransmitter can activate its receptor for longer periods of time. Iproniazid and phenelzine are two such drugs.

O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 24

Liquid dishwashing agents are

Detailed Solution for O.P Tandon Test: Chemistry in Everyday Life (Old NCERT) - Question 24

Liquid dishwashing agents are non ionic detergents. Since the detergent does not have any ionic groups, it does not react with hard water ions but can remove grease and oil by micelle formation.
